Output 3cfe76128ea61652d4545d441b69c852fc538c421b250c3723e477fb16cf5409:0

value
102164357
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a3af444cb799c5f0a99397d4506915efd108bdc OP_EQUALVERIFY OP_CHECKSIG
address
1DbtsgU6hywSGTcF743j4b3HGXoQdkopU6
transaction
3cfe76128ea61652d4545d441b69c852fc538c421b250c3723e477fb16cf5409
spent
true